golang有前景么

admin 2024-11-09 16:37:39 编程 来源:ZONE.CI 全球网 0 阅读模式

Go语言,又称Golang,是一种由Google开发的开源编程语言,于2007年推出。Go语言的设计目标主要包括高效编译、高效执行以及简洁的语法。自问世以来,Go语言在全球范围内得到了广泛的应用和认可。那么,Go语言是否有前景呢?接下来,我将通过三个方面来解释。

易学易用

首先,Go语言具有非常简洁和直观的语法,使其易于学习和使用。Go语言的语法规范度很高,没有冗余的语法元素。相比于其他编程语言,Go语言的学习曲线更加平滑,新手可以快速上手进行开发。此外,Go语言还提供了丰富的标准库,能够满足大部分常见的开发需求,使得开发人员能够更加高效地完成任务。

强大的并发性

第二,Go语言在并发性方面表现出色。Go语言内置了轻量级的Goroutine和通道(Channel)机制,使得并发编程变得更加简单和高效。Goroutine是Go语言中的轻量级线程,可以在程序中并发运行。而通道则是Goroutine之间进行安全数据传输的桥梁,有效地解决了多线程并发操作共享数据的难题。通过这两个特性,Go语言能够轻松应对高并发的场景,保证系统的稳定和响应速度。

强大的生态系统

最后,Go语言拥有庞大而活跃的开源社区,构建了非常完善的生态系统。在Go语言的生态系统中,有大量优秀的开源项目和库可供选择和使用。例如,Docker、Kubernetes等知名项目都是使用Go语言开发。同时,Go语言还支持交叉编译,使得开发者可以将Go语言编写的程序轻松部署到各种平台上。这些优秀的工具和技术为Go语言开发者提供了丰富的可能性和选项,极大地提升了开发效率。

综上所述,Go语言具有易学易用、强大的并发性和丰富的生态系统三个核心特点,使其成为一门具有巨大前景的编程语言。随着云计算、大数据和人工智能等技术的不断发展,对高性能和高效率的需求也越来越迫切,而Go语言正好满足了这些需求。因此,我们可以相信Go语言将在未来继续蓬勃发展,并持续为开发者带来更多便利和机遇。

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ang有前景么 编程

golang有前景么

Go语言,又称Golang,是一种由Google开发的开源编程语言,于2007年推出。Go语言的设计目标主要包括高效编译、高效执行以及简洁的语法。自问世以来,G
Golang队列任务 编程

Golang队列任务

在计算机编程领域,队列是一种常用的数据结构,用于存储和管理数据集合。在Golang中,队列的实现相对简单而且高效,使得开发者能够轻松地处理各种任务。本文将介绍G
golang的内存分配 编程

golang的内存分配

在现代编程语言中,内存分配和管理是一个关键问题。Golang作为一门高性能的编程语言以其独特的垃圾回收机制而闻名。Golang的内存分配器不仅可以实现自动内存回
golang containsany 编程

golang containsany

Golang是一种开源的静态类型编程语言,由Google开发。它因其简单易用、高效性能和并发处理能力而备受开发者欢迎。在Golang的标准库中,我们可以找到许多
评论:0   参与:  0